Cabin intruder
January 4, 2009
I have access to a remote little cabin that I frequent during the summer months that sits in the heart of some of the most wild beautiful country in the heart of Alaska’s Brooks Range. The only problem that I encounter sometimes while visiting there, is rogue grizzly bears on the hunt for something tasty.
Hiking up to the cabin last week, I noticed that the front door was badly damaged but still shut. I knew instantly that a bear had tried to break it down because of all the claw marks that it had left. The hinges to the door were almost knocked loose, but thanks to the strong mortise lock, the bruin couldn’t gain entry. After securing the door with larger hinges, I felt much better now knowing that all was safe.
